Stayed 2 nights, very clean, in the heart of Andong town, 2 mins walk from train station. (By the way, the bus station has moved to a location not near the main town. So lonely planet map is now incorrect). It's not really a love motel. Prices start from 40,000 won. Our double room was 50,000 won. It was very... More

Quiete, centrally located. PCs in the room, but no wifi. Very clean. Heated toilet seat. Only non-english tv channels except axn. Only downside is hard beds (which are ok for us) and rock hard pillows (which are not)! and taking showes makes the whole bathroom wet. Great price and nice big room.
